Pecan Crusted Rum & Coke Ham
- 1 whole Pre-cooked (not Sliced) Ham Shank 8-12 Pounds
- 9 cups, 8 tablespoons, 7-78 pinches Cola (preferably Coca-Cola), Divided Use
- 2 cups Spiced Rum (I Love Sailor Jerry's), Divided Use
- 1 stick Butter
- 1/2 cups Brown Sugar
- 2 Tablespoons Cayenne Pepper (or Less If You Prefer)
- 2 cups Chopped Pecans
- Salt And Pepper
- Mesquite Wood Chips
- Rectangular Aluminum Pan
- Clean Cooler Or Large Pot (big Enought To Fit The Ham And Cover It In Cola)
- Place the ham in a large pot and submerge it in 2 liters of cola.
- Brine the ham in the cola for 24 hours either at room temperature or in the refrigerator.
- Remove the ham from the brine and place flat side down in an aluminum foil pan.
- Score the outside of the ham.
- Pour 2 cups of cola and 1 cup rum into the pan.
- Prepare you grill for indirect grilling at a low temperature (around 325 degrees F).
- Place the pan with the ham on the grill and add your wood chips.
- Smoke the ham for at least 30 minutes (feel free to smoke longer if preferred).
- While the ham is smoking prepare your basting sauce: Over medium heat in a small sauce pan mix together 1 cup of rum, 1 stick of butter, and 1/2 cup of brown sugar, stirring until butter is completely melted.
- After one hour of cooking begin basting the ham every 15 minutes with the sauce.
- After the ham has cooked for two hours (or reached an internal temperature of 150 degrees) add cayenne, chopped pecans, salt and pepper to taste to the remaining basting sauce.
- Stir until thoroughly mixed.
- Remove the ham from the grill.
- Take the pecan mixture and gently apply it to the outside of the ham (some of the mix will fall from the ham).
- Return the ham to the grill and cook until the pecan topping is slightly toasted and there is an internal temperature of 160.
- Remove from grill and place ham on a cutting board to rest for 5 minutes before cutting.
- Slice and enjoy!
